Longhorns strike fast, receive first 2016 commitment in Manvel WR Reggie Hemphill

https://www.hornsports.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/08/HSRU.jpgIt’s never too early to plan for great things.  Right?  Absolutely not if you’re Mack Brown and the Texas Longhorns.  On Tuesday Reggie Hemphill, wide receiver from Manvel High School (Class of 2016) verbally committed to play football for the Longhorns.

You read that right – Class of 2016.

ADVERTISEMENT

 

 

 

Hemphill,  6-1, 175 lbs., attended a Texas camp in June and followed up by attending the inaugural Texas Stampede recruiting event last month.  His scholarship offer came at the June camp in which he impressed the coaching staff with his speed, size and prowess on the field.  Hemphill had interest in Texas A&M and attended a summer camp in College Station along with Manvel teammate Deontay Anderson (safety/athlete), who also has Texas on his list of favorites.

 

 

 

National Signing Day 2016 is two and a half years away and Texas fans shouldn’t be surprised when outside offers begin to pour in for Hemphill over the next year or two.  Hemphill has all the tools and promise to be a premier wide receiver at the collegiate level.

 

 

 

Hats off to Mack Brown and Patrick Suddes for jump-starting the ’16 class with Hemphill.

 

 

 

[colored_box color=yellow]Hemphill stats in 2012 – 2013 as a Freshman:

 

 

Receiving:  10 catches for 400 yards & 6 touchdowns.

 

Rushing:  11 carries for 101 yards

 

Passing:  3-7 for 25 yards[/colored_box]
